What is Sympathy for the Devil (2019) about?
*Sympathy for the Devil* follows Paul, a man navigating a war-torn city where survival is a daily struggle. As he balances the risks of journalism with the search for love, he confronts the harsh realities of conflict and the moral dilemmas that come with it.
Who directed Sympathy for the Devil?
The film was directed by Guillaume de Fontenay, who brings a raw, immersive style to this intense war drama.
Who stars in Sympathy for the Devil?
The cast includes Niels Schneider as Paul, Ella Rumpf, Izudin Bajrović, Adnan Omerović, and Mirsad Ibišević in pivotal roles.

About Sympathy for the Devil (2019) — A Gritty War Drama of Survival and Sacrifice
Directed by Guillaume de Fontenay, *Sympathy for the Devil (2019)* plunges viewers into the heart of an urban war zone where survival is a daily battle and every shadow could hide a threat. The film follows Paul, a man caught between the brutal realities of conflict and the fragile bonds of love and journalism, as he navigates a city where trust is a luxury and danger lurks in every corner. With a raw, unflinching visual style, de Fontenay crafts a tense atmosphere where the line between hero and victim blurs under the weight of war's chaos.
Starring Niels Schneider as the determined Paul and Ella Rumpf as his resilient counterpart, this war drama weaves a story of resilience and moral ambiguity against a backdrop of destruction.
